Owasso Recycling Ctr

Owasso Recycling Ctr is a company Located at Owasso,Oklahoma,United States with a telephone number 9182724991, (918)272-4991.Provided Executive, Legislative, and General Government except Finance products and service.
Contact Info
Map
Map of Owasso Recycling Ctr, address:499 S Main St,Owasso,Oklahoma,United States.